Output e6651123ddb42654b20a253db9c404f21ff8883ded32d095d95c6ad9aea4c909: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1c14dcfc3d3ffaf9bf3b0318b18c029076820d OP_EQUAL
address
38YAF4sq462x3cdyMWkCVnPiG5eW8zwFzV
transaction
e6651123ddb42654b20a253db9c404f21ff8883ded32d095d95c6ad9aea4c909
spent
true